Web & Mobile Application Development Company: How to Choose the Right Partner for Your Business
15 January 2026
7 minutes

Web & Mobile Application Development Company: How to Choose the Right Partner for Your Business
Choosing a web and mobile application development company is a strategic decision that affects far more than the technical side of a project. The right development partner influences how quickly your product reaches the market, how well it scales, how stable it remains over time, and how effectively it supports business growth.
Today, digital products are often the core of a company’s operations. Web platforms, internal systems, SaaS products, and customer-facing applications directly impact revenue, customer experience, and operational efficiency. Because of this, working with a reliable web application development company or web app development company is not just about writing code - it is about building a long-term foundation for your business.
This article explains what web and mobile application development companies actually do, how they differ from one another, and how to choose a partner that aligns with your business objectives rather than simply offering the lowest price.
What a Web & Mobile Application Development Company Does
A web and mobile application development company designs, builds, and maintains software products for web browsers and mobile devices. Unlike freelancers or narrowly specialized teams, such companies typically provide a structured development process, experienced engineers, and long-term technical support.
A professional web application development company works with businesses at different stages - from early idea validation to large-scale enterprise platforms. Its role is not limited to implementation. In many cases, it also includes consulting on architecture, performance, scalability, and integration with third-party systems.
From a business point of view, the value of working with an established web app development company lies in predictability. Clear processes, documented workflows, and experienced teams help reduce risks, control costs, and avoid common problems such as poor performance, security issues, or technical debt that limits future growth.
Web Application Development vs Mobile Application Development
Before choosing a development partner, it is important to understand whether your business needs a web solution, a mobile application, or a combination of both. Although these approaches often overlap, they serve different purposes and business scenarios.
When a Web Application Development Company Is the Right Choice
A web application development company is usually the best option when the product needs to be accessible through a browser across different devices and operating systems. Web applications are widely used for SaaS platforms, internal business systems, dashboards, analytics tools, and customer portals.
From an operational standpoint, web applications are easier to deploy and maintain. Updates can be released instantly without requiring users to install new versions. This makes web solutions especially effective for businesses that iterate frequently or rely on rapid feature delivery.
A strong web app development company focuses on performance optimization, security, scalability, and compatibility. These factors become critical as user numbers grow and the application evolves over time.
When to Work with a Mobile App Development Company
Mobile application development is more suitable when user engagement, native device functionality, or offline access is essential. Consumer-facing products, marketplaces, location-based services, and on-demand platforms often rely on mobile applications to deliver the best user experience.
While mobile apps offer deeper integration with device features, they also require platform-specific expertise and ongoing maintenance. For this reason, many businesses choose to work with a web and mobile application development company that can deliver both mobile apps and supporting web platforms, such as admin panels or dashboards.
Types of Application Development Companies
Not all development companies operate using the same model. Understanding the main types of application development companies helps businesses choose a partner that matches their internal capabilities and expectations.
A full-cycle application development company manages the entire product lifecycle. This includes requirements analysis, design, development, testing, deployment, and post-launch support. This model works well for businesses that want a single point of responsibility and minimal coordination overhead.
Some companies focus primarily on web solutions and position themselves as a specialized web application development company. Others provide cross-platform expertise and cover both web and mobile development under one roof. Businesses that plan to expand their product ecosystem often benefit from working with a web and mobile app development company that can scale alongside them.
How to Choose the Right Web & Mobile Application Development Company
Selecting the right development partner requires more than reviewing portfolios or comparing hourly rates. A reliable web application development company should demonstrate a deep understanding of business needs, technical requirements, and long-term product strategy.
Relevant Experience and Proven Results
Experience matters not only in terms of years but also in relevance. A professional web app development company should be able to show projects similar in complexity, scale, or industry. Case studies should explain real challenges, implementation decisions, and outcomes, not just showcase visuals.
Businesses should pay attention to how a development company discusses previous projects. Clear explanations and realistic assessments are often a sign of practical experience rather than theoretical knowledge.
Technical Expertise and Architecture Decisions
A strong web application development company does not simply follow trends. Technology choices should be justified based on performance, security, maintainability, and scalability. Early architectural decisions have a long-term impact on how easily a product can evolve.
A reliable development partner considers future growth from the beginning, ensuring that the application can handle increased traffic, new features, and integrations without major rewrites.
Communication and Development Process
Clear communication is one of the most important success factors in software development. A professional web app development company provides structured workflows, regular updates, and transparent reporting.
Agile development methodologies are commonly used to allow flexibility, continuous feedback, and early detection of issues. From a business perspective, this reduces uncertainty and ensures that stakeholders remain aligned throughout the project.
Why Discovery and Planning Are Critical
Many software projects fail not because of poor coding but because of insufficient planning. A mature web application development company invests time in discovery to clarify business goals, user expectations, and technical constraints before development begins.
Discovery typically includes requirement analysis, user journey mapping, and technical feasibility assessment. While this phase adds time and cost at the beginning, it significantly reduces risks later in the project.
Businesses that skip discovery often face scope changes, missed deadlines, and budget overruns. A structured planning phase creates a solid foundation for development and helps avoid costly mistakes.
How Development Decisions Affect Business Growth
Choosing a web app development company is not just about launching a product. Development decisions influence long-term business outcomes, including scalability, maintenance costs, and speed of innovation.
Well-designed applications are easier to update, scale, and adapt to market changes. Poor technical decisions, on the other hand, often result in increased costs, performance issues, and limitations that restrict growth.
An experienced web application development company understands these trade-offs and helps businesses balance short-term delivery with long-term sustainability.
Cost of Web & Mobile Application Development
Cost is one of the most common concerns when selecting a development partner. However, there is no fixed price for web or mobile application development. Costs depend on project scope, complexity, technology stack, and team composition.
Lower-priced vendors may seem attractive initially, but they often lack structured processes or experienced engineers. This can lead to delays, quality issues, or the need to rebuild the product later. A reliable web application development company focuses on delivering value rather than offering the lowest possible estimate.
From a business perspective, the real question is not how much development costs, but how effectively that investment supports long-term goals.
Common Mistakes When Hiring a Web App Development Company
One of the most common mistakes is choosing a vendor based solely on price. While budgets are important, prioritizing cost over experience often leads to higher expenses in the long run.
Another frequent issue is unclear requirements. Even the most experienced web app development company needs a clear vision to deliver the expected result. Investing time in planning and documentation significantly improves outcomes.
Some businesses also underestimate the importance of post-launch support. A professional development partner views launch as the beginning of a product’s lifecycle, not the end of a project.
Building a Long-Term Partnership Instead of a One-Time Project
The most successful digital products are built through long-term collaboration. When a web application development company truly understands a client’s business, it can proactively suggest improvements, optimize performance, and support continuous growth.
Long-term partnerships reduce onboarding costs, improve efficiency, and create shared ownership of product success. Over time, the development team becomes deeply familiar with the product, which leads to better decision-making and faster delivery.
Choosing a Web Application Development Company That Fits Your Business Goals
Ultimately, the right web app development company is one that aligns with your business objectives, understands your market, and can support your product beyond its initial release. Technical skills are essential, but they are only part of the equation.
By focusing on experience, communication, planning, and long-term thinking, businesses can choose a web application development company that delivers not just software, but real business value.
In a competitive digital landscape, the right development partner becomes a strategic asset - one that supports innovation, scalability, and sustainable growth.
Your idea - our execution. Let's create meaningful solutions together!
Contact ustags

Best Map API for Location-Based Services: Mapbox vs Google Maps vs OpenStreetMap
August 2, 2021
Full-Cycle Software Development Services: From Idea to Market-Ready Product
January 26, 2026
Why GreenTech Can Become a Major Part of Your Business Strategy
July 24, 2023